MRS. LA FAYE DUREN
LaFaye Carpenter Duren serves as the organist of Second Baptist Church. She received her degree in music from Our Lady of the Lake University, with a concentration in organ and piano. Her advanced studies were completed at Texas Wesleyan University and the University of the Incarnate Word. Each summer she continues the study of the organ and sacred music.
Her repertoire includes arrangements of the African American Spirituals, fanfares and the great hymns of the church.
LaFaye Duren is recognized by Second Baptist Church for her many years of service. She is the recipient of the Distinguished Service Award and Certificate of Church Organist Extraordinaire. She has also been recognized by the Chancel, Contemporaries and Men’s Choirs.
In addition to her duties as organist, she is a teacher at St. Peter Prince of the Apostles where she works with the Language Arts and Music department.
The professional awards she has received are Outstanding Leader in Catholic Education, Phi Delta Kappa Educator’s Hall of Fame, Who’s Who Among America’s Teachers, Sunshine Cottage School for the Deaf Teacher of the Year, Radio Station Magic 105 Teacher of the Month, National Honor Roll, and Teacher’s Who Make A Difference.
She is a member of the American Guild of Organists and Alpha Kappa Alpha Sorority
